How much do entry level recent graduate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 26,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level recent graduate in Miami, FL is $45,748.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,700.00 and $49,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are entry level recent graduate jobs?

Entry level recent graduate jobs are positions designed for individuals who have recently completed their college degrees and are starting their professional careers. These roles typically require little to no prior work experience and offer on-the-job training to help new graduates develop essential skills. Common industries hiring recent graduates include business, technology, healthcare, and education. Employers look for candidates with relevant coursework, internships, and a willingness to learn. Entry level jobs help graduates gain practical experience and serve as a stepping stone for future career growth.

What types of projects or responsibilities can an entry level recent graduate expect in their first few months on the job?

As an entry-level recent graduate, you can anticipate working on foundational tasks that help you build practical skills and become familiar with company processes. This may include assisting with data analysis, supporting team projects, shadowing experienced colleagues, and handling day-to-day administrative duties. You'll likely receive structured training and regular feedback, and have opportunities to participate in cross-functional meetings to better understand how your role fits within the broader organization. These experiences are designed to help you gradually take on more complex assignments as you develop confidence and expertise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level recent graduate, and why are they important?

To succeed as an Entry Level Recent Graduate, you generally need a relevant academic degree, foundational knowledge in your field, and strong problem-solving abilities. Familiarity with industry-standard software, basic data analysis tools, or productivity platforms such as Microsoft Office or Google Workspace is often expected. Strong communication, willingness to learn, and adaptability help you stand out in a competitive environment. These skills and qualities enable you to quickly contribute, collaborate effectively, and grow in your new role.
